COLUMBUS, OH, January 21, 2024 - Planet TV Studios, a recognized creator of ground-breaking tv series, happily announces its most recent documentary series, "New Frontiers," showcasing the revolutionary triumphs of Andelyn Biosciences. This particular documentary will investigate the progressive advances crafted by Andelyn Biosciences, a leading gene therapy Contract Development and Manufacturing Organization (CDMO), in the compelling space of biotechnology.

"New Frontiers" is a thought-provoking series diligently developed to peek into state-of-the-art businesses that are at the top of framing the future of medical care across the world. The documentary episodes will be airing early 2024 on national television, Bloomberg TV, and available on on-demand via different platforms, including Amazon, Google Play, Roku, and more.

Planet TV Studios is delighted to have Gina Grad returning as their host. Gina is an established author, podcast host, and radio personality based in Los Angeles, California. She previously worked as the co-host and news anchor of the Adam Carolla Show, a podcast that held the Guinness World Record for the most downloaded episodes. Gina has also anchored on KFI 640 AM and hosted mornings on 100.3 FM. Along with her broadcasting work, she is the writer of "My Extra Mom," a children's book designed to help kids and stepparents in navigating the difficulties of blended families.

Inside the challenging arena of biotechnology, Andelyn Biosciences has blossomed as a visionary, advancing ground breaking therapies and contributing considerably to the biopharmaceutical business. Founded in 2020, the firm, headquartered in Columbus, Ohio, launched out of Nationwide Children's Hospital's Abigail Wexner Research Institute along with a goal to accelerating the expansion and manufacturing of innovative therapies to bring more treatments to more patients.

Viral Vectors

Viruses have evolved to efficiently deliver genetic material into host cells, making them an effective tool for DNA-based treatment. Frequently employed virus-based carriers consist of:

Adenoviral vectors – Able to penetrate both dividing and quiescent cells but may provoke host defenses.

Adeno-Associated Viruses (AAVs) – Highly regarded due to their minimal antigenicity and potential to ensure extended gene expression.

Retroviruses and Lentiviruses – Incorporate into the recipient's DNA, providing stable gene expression, with HIV-derived carriers being particularly advantageous for targeting non-dividing cells.

Alternative check over here Genetic Delivery Methods

Non-viral delivery methods present a less immunogenic choice, minimizing host rejection. These include:

Lipid-based carriers and nano-delivery systems – Coating DNA or RNA for effective cellular uptake.

Electropulse Gene Transfer – Using electrical pulses to generate permeable spots in biological enclosures, permitting nucleic acid infiltration.

Direct Injection – Administering DNA sequences straight into specific organs.

Understanding the Biological Foundations of Cell and Gene Therapies

Exploring Cell Therapy: The Future of Medicine

Regenerative approaches harnesses the restoration capabilities of cells to combat ailments. Major innovations encompass:

Hematopoietic Stem Cell Transplants (HSCT):
Used to manage oncological and immunological illnesses by reviving marrow production by integrating functional cell lines.

Chimeric Antigen Receptor T-Cell Therapy: A revolutionary malignancy-fighting method in which a person’s lymphocytes are tailored to target with precision and combat tumorous cells.

Mesenchymal Stem Cell Therapy: Examined for its clinical applications in mitigating self-attacking conditions, orthopedic injuries, and neurological diseases.

Genetic Engineering Solutions: Altering the Fundamental Biology

Gene therapy functions through adjusting the core defect of chromosomal abnormalities:

Direct Genetic Therapy: Introduces genetic material immediately within the individual’s system, including the clinically endorsed Spark have a peek at this web-site Therapeutics’ Luxturna for managing genetic eye conditions.

Cell-Extraction Gene Treatment: Entails modifying a individual’s tissues in a lab and then implanting them, as applied in some emerging solutions for hereditary blood ailments and weakened immune conditions.

The advent of cutting-edge CRISPR technology has rapidly progressed gene therapy research, enabling fine-tuned edits at the chromosomal sequences.
